2. Obstacles Of Recycling Solar Panels
It is extensively accepted that recycling solar panels has lots of ecological benefits, nonetheless, it is additionally true that the process isn't without its difficulties. Yet just what are these challenges? Let's investigate even more.
One of the greatest problems with recycling photovoltaic panels is the intricacy of the job itself. It can be tough to break down the various elements, such as glass and steel, to be reused independently. Additionally, photovoltaic panel makers usually have a mix of materials used in their products which makes arranging them much more challenging. Furthermore, there are safety and wellness threats entailed with handling broken glass or breathing in fumes from thawing parts.
An additional key challenge associated with reusing solar panels is cost. Lots of countries do not have enough infrastructure or sources to effectively recycle these products which leads to higher costs for organizations attempting to do so. Furthermore, due to the customized nature of recycling solar panels, this can develop a financial worry on companies trying to stay certified with guidelines. Eventually, these expenses could be given to customers making it tough for them to afford renewable resource sources.

3. Techniques For Reusing Solar Panels
As the globe strives for a more lasting future, recycling photovoltaic panels is a progressively prominent job. Amidst this expanding passion, nonetheless, we have to think about the techniques that are in place to make it feasible.
To start with, many business have actually carried out a 'take-back' system wherein old or broken solar panels can be gathered and sent out to their respective factories for recycling. By doing this, the products have the ability to be reused in the building of brand-new products. Furthermore, some communities have actually also begun supplying incentives for people wishing to reuse their photovoltaic panels; this might vary from tax obligation breaks to free shipping expenses.
Furthermore, modern technology has actually ended up being increasingly sophisticated when it concerns reusing photovoltaic panels-- with specialized machines capable of separating out all the different parts within them. As an example, by utilizing AI-powered robot arms, these equipments can remove beneficial materials such as copper and aluminium while also taking care of contaminated materials safely.
